CVE-2019-18635 : What You Need to Know

Discover the impact of CVE-2019-18635 found in Mooltipass Moolticute versions 0.42.1 to 0.42.5-testing, leading to a NULL pointer dereference in MPDevice_win.cpp. Learn about mitigation strategies and preventive measures.

A problem has been found in versions 0.42.1 and 0.42.x-testing to 0.42.5-testing of Mooltipass Moolticute where a NULL pointer is accessed incorrectly in the file MPDevice_win.cpp.

Understanding CVE-2019-18635

An issue was discovered in Mooltipass Moolticute through v0.42.1 and v0.42.x-testing through v0.42.5-testing, leading to a NULL pointer dereference in MPDevice_win.cpp.

What is CVE-2019-18635?

This CVE identifies a vulnerability in Mooltipass Moolticute versions 0.42.1 to 0.42.5-testing, allowing incorrect access to a NULL pointer in MPDevice_win.cpp.

The Impact of CVE-2019-18635

The vulnerability could be exploited by an attacker to cause a denial of service or potentially execute arbitrary code on the affected system.

Technical Details of CVE-2019-18635

The following technical details provide insight into the vulnerability.

Vulnerability Description

A NULL pointer dereference occurs in the file MPDevice_win.cpp in Mooltipass Moolticute versions 0.42.1 to 0.42.5-testing.

Affected Systems and Versions

        Versions 0.42.1 to 0.42.5-testing of Mooltipass Moolticute

Exploitation Mechanism

The vulnerability allows attackers to exploit the NULL pointer dereference in MPDevice_win.cpp, potentially leading to a denial of service or arbitrary code execution.
